摘要:In an attempt to improve the procedures for statistical process control many researchers have developed and proposed a variety of adaptive control charts in the last decade The common characteristic of those charts is that one or more of the chart parameters (sampling interval sample size control limits) is allowed to change during operation taking into account current sample information Due to their flexibility adaptive charts are more effective than their static counterparts but they are als...

摘要:We study a single product assembly system in which the final product is assembled to order whereas the components (subassemblies) are built to stock Customer demand follows a Poisson process and replenishment lead times for each component are independent and identically distributed random variables For any given base-stock policy the exact performance analysis reduces to the evaluation of a set of M/G/infinity queues with a common arrival stream We show that unlike the standard M/G/infinity qu...

摘要:Online models for real-time operations planning face a host of implementation issues that do not a-rise in more strategic arenas. We use the seemingly simple problem of assigning drivers to loads in the truckload motor carrier industry as an instance to study the issues that arise in the process of implementing a real-time dispatch system. 摘要:We describe a large-scale linear programming model for optimizing strategic (intercontinental) airlift capability. The model routes cargo and passengers through a specified transportation network with a given fleet of aircraft subject to many physical and policy Constraints. 摘要:We present an approach to the admission control and resource allocation problem in connection-oriented networks that offer multiple services to users. Users' preferences are summarized by means of their utility functions, and each user is allowed to request more than one type of service. Multiple types of resources are allocated at each link along the path of a connection. 摘要:The network, restoration problem is a specialized capacitated network design problem requiring the installation of spare capacity to fully restore disrupted network flows if any edge in a telecommunications network fails. We present a new mixed-integer programming formulation for a line restoration version of the problem using a single type of capacitated facility. 摘要:A new interior-point algorithm for solving the groundwater-pollution-control design problem is presented. The algorithm requires that the objective function is differentiable in the interior region. Fur minimization problems with nonlinear constraint, and a concave objective function, the technique is shown to be similar to an active set gradient-projection method, where the tangent of the boundary between feasible and infeasible solutions is used to determine a search direction. 摘要:This paper develops a new nonparametric model for efficiency estimation. In contrast to Data Envelopment Analysis (DEA), it does not impose debatable production assumptions like free disposability and convexity, and it does not assume that the data are measured without error. 摘要:This paper is concerned with applying the Reformulation-Linearization Technique (RLT) to derive tighter relaxations for the Asymmetric Traveling Salesman Problem (ATSP) formulation that is based on the Miller-Tucker-Zemlin (MTZ) subtour elimination constraints. The MTZ constraints yield a compact representation for the Traveling Salesman Problem (TSP), and their use is particularly attractive in various routing and scheduling contexts that have an embedded ATSP structure.
